AP_plic,ation to Planning Commission: ,In an effort to aid the
~icant, the Planning Department requests that ,it be given
an opportunity to evaluate and discuss the application in its
various stages of development priar to submittal. It is more
effective'if applicant meets directly with staff; however,
written or telephone communication is acceptable. It is the
responsibility of the applicant to make the initial contact
for such meeting.
Submittal: Application will be accepted only if the applica-
tion, plans and other pertinent materials are complete.
Generally, the date application will be heard will be deter-
mtned By the submittal date as indicated within the approved
planning Commission calendar.
Planning Commission Calendar: The Planning Commission:~dopts
an annual calendar that indicates application ~losjng dates)
staff review dates, staff report completion dates, and Pl~n
ning Commission hearing dates. You may acquire this calendar
at the Planning Department.
Staff Review: On the date as indicated on the Planning Commission
Calendar, City Staff conducts a review meeting on all items on
the Planning Commission agenda. The applicant is invited to
attend an~ to explain the project and respond to staff preliminary
recommendations. Upon completion of this review, Staff will pre-
pare final staff recommendations to be submitted to the Planning
Commission. The final report with recommendations will be
available at the Planning Department five days prior to the
Planning Commission hearing (Friday afternoon prior to the
Plann~ng Commission meeting date).
Hearing: The Planning Commission meets every 2nd and 4th
Wednesday· of the month at 7:30 p.m. or as indicated on the
Planning Commission calendar. Depending on the type of appli-
cation, the Planning Commission will either make a finding
and forward to City Councilor make final action.
Appeals: Final action by Planning Commission may be appealed
to the City Council, provided such appeal is filed within ten
(10), days after the Planning Commission actioh. The applicant
shou1d review with staff the procedure on the various types of
applications.
Final Decision: The City will notify the applicant and property
owner of the final decision. , .-

ARTICLE II
GENERAL RESTRICTIONS
Section 1. Uses Other than Residential Prohibited.
All of the parc~ls shall be used only for residential purposes
as herein provided; and, no part of the subdivision, ..or any
parcel contained therein, shall be used, caused to be used, or
r '.'
-2-
• t. ~'~ r" f)f' '1
• I' I'! •
• " I
,.t' ,'1' •
permitted to be used, in any way, directly or indirectly,
for (i) any business or profession, '(ii) any commercial,
manufacturing, educational, religious, medical, institu-
tional, or other non-residential purpose, (iii) the carrying
on of any noxious activity or pursuit, or (iv) any act or
thing which may be, or become, an annoyance or nuisance to
any owner.
Section 2. Oil Drilling, Mining and Gravel Excavating
Prohibited. Prospecting, mining or boring for oil, natural
gas, kindred substances, ore, or minerals, on any part of
'the subdivision, or on or in any parcel, shall not be done
or permitted at any time; and, no sand, gravel, or soil shall
be excavated or dug out of any of the parcels at any time,
except for the specific purposes of laying the foundations
grading for the construction of such residences or related
improvements, improving the gardens or grounds thereof, or
installing pipes and utilities; provided, however, that
Declarant, in carrying out the initial improvement and
development of the subdivision, shall have the right to
remove or add to any soil on any parcel, and shall have the
right of ingress to and egress from all parcels for the
purposes of grading, constructing and completing street
improvements, iristallation of utilities and the carrying out
of all other matters necessary to complete Declarant's plans
of improvement.
Section 3. Regulations Regarding Live-Stock, Poultry,
Bees, Commercial Pet Raising, Etc. No animal, fish or pet
raising 'or trading as a business shall be carried on, directly
or indirectly, on any part of the subdivision or on any parcel.
Section 4. Occupancy of Unfinished Residence and
Other s.tructures Prohibited; Limitations on Use of Signs.
No residence within the subdivision shall, in any manner, be
occupied or lived in while in the course of original construc-
tion, or until made to comply with all requirements as to
area, all other conditions set forth or referred to herein
and any further restrictions established and applicable
thereto. No structure anywhere in the subdivision, other
than a residence, shall ever be lived in or used for dwelling
purposes, including tents, shacks, trailers, campers, motor
'homes, mobile homes, out-buildings, garages, or other such
structures; nor shall any sign or billboard be erected,
placed, or maintained on any parcel, except individual
"For Sale" or "For Rent" signs used in connection with the
selling or renting of individual parcels or residences. Only
one "For Sale" or "For Rent" sign may be maintained, at any
time, on a parcel or residence; and, it shall not exceed the
dimensions of 18" x 24", shall be professionally lettered,
shall contain no price,"~~~ shall contain only the usual
information concerning the name, address and telephone number
of the owner or his duly authorized broker; however, nothing
in this section shall be construed to prevent the erection,
placement or maintenance, by Declarant or duly authorized
agents, of ~igns, trailers, offices or buildings in c6nnection
with the conduct of its business, or the development and
sale of any part of the subdivision or any parcel.
Section 5. Privies. No privy shall be erected, main-
tained or used upon any part of the subdivision, except that
a temporary privy may be permitted during the course of
construction of a residence or structure. Any lavatory, toilet
"
-4-
4 _____ •• _~. ___ .... ~ ....... ,...,,." ... ""'II ......... _ ••• ,.,.
,-.'
t', '.'l1'jht'I'rpllj'~' ...
'I" t I
l' ," ,
j
1
I
I
I
I
J '
I
, ,
'"
or water closet 'that shall be erected, maintained or
used on any parcel shall be enclose~ and located within a
residence or structure herein permitted to be erected on
said parcel.
Section 6. Parcels to be kept Cleared of Weeds and Rubbish,
and Slopes to be Maintained. Each owner shall plant, ke~?,
maintain, water and replant all slope banks located on his
parcel" so as to prevent erosion and create an attractive appearance
appearance. ~o structure, planting or other, material shall
be placed or permitted to remain, and no activities shall be
'undertaken, on any of the slope banks, which may damage or '
interfere with established slope banks, create erosion or
sliding problems, or which may change the direction or flow
of drainage ~hannels or obstruct or retard the flow of wate~
through drainage channels.
Each owner s4all keep his parcel free and clear of all
weeds and rubbish and do all other things necessary or
desirable to keep same neat, in good order and condition,
and properly planted and. landscaped.
Section 7. Vehicle Storage or Repairs. No vehicle,
boat, or equipment of any kind or nature shall be kept,
stored, maintained, overhauled or repaired on any parcel or
in, or on any public street adjacent thereto unless the same
be, fully enclosed in a garage or other outbuilding.
Section 8. Local Law. All of the ordinances" regula-~~~~~~--~~~----
tions and resolutions of the City of Carlsbad, California,
pertaining to the construction of dwelling units or the
zoning thereof which are now in effect or which may become
effective hereafter shall be followed and observed by each
owner.
-s~
" '
"I I , I'
:'". ".
Section 9. No Offensive Activity. No noxious or
offensive activity shall be carried on, nor shall anything
be done which may be or may become an annoyance or nuisance;
normal and usual construction activities associated with the
installation or repair of any improvement permitted by this
Declaration shall not constitute noxious or offensive acitvity
or an annoyance or nuisance within the meaning of this
seqtion.
ARTICLE III
BUILDING AND PLANTING RESTRICTIONS
, " Section 1. Single Family Residences. No building,
structure or premises shall be erected, constructed, altered
or m~intained on any parcel, except one single family res i-
denoe, with garage. Such residence may include dust.omary or
necessary accessory structures appurtenant thereto. No suah
residence shall ever be used, designated, or intended to be
used, for any purpose other than exclusively for private,
single family, residential occupancy and use.
Section 2. Moving. of. Buildings or Trailers on to
Property Prohibited. Except as permitted by Section '4 of
Article II, no residence, structure or trailer, shall be
moved onto any part of the subdivision, or onto any parcel.
Section 3. Minimum Size of Residences. No residence
shall be erected, placed, permitted or maintained on any parcel
which shall have a floor area of less than 1600 square feet,
excluding any portion used for outside or open porches, patios,
basements, garages, or breezeways.
Section 4. Maintenance and Repair of Landscaping and
Improvements. The exteriors of all improvements on each parcel
shall be regularly maintained, painted and repaired (including
replacement where required) in good,. sightly and well-kept
-6-
J:
I , ,: :r',
" I, '\ "'1 , I .
I,' ;'I"!
,l ' " '
I
!
1 ,
I
I
I
I
"
order, repair and condition. Each owner shall maintain the
landscaping upon his parcel in good condition, removing all
. weeds, and water~ng and'trimming lawns and shrubs as.often
as the same shall become reasonably necessary.
Section 5. Roofs. The roofs shall be constructed of
noncombustible material.
Section 6. Fences. No fence shall be constructed of
barbed wire of any kind. All fences constructed shall be
painted or stai~ed and shall be maintained in 'good condition
and repair.
